Vehicle Description
Often credited with creating and popularizing the "personal luxury
car", the legendary Ford Thunderbird is renowned for its blend of
sports car and luxury car characteristics as well as its large
engine options and attractive styling. This particular example, a
gorgeous 1966 model T-Bird, is a true survivor car with a single
repaint and only 101,410 original miles showing on the odometer!
Given the car's age, milage like that reflects extraordinary care
over the decades. Popping open the hood reveals a massive 428 C.I.
V8 breathing through a 4-barrel carburetor, which allows this
T-Bird to glide down the interstate effortlessly. Torque is put to
the pavement through a smooth-shifting 3-speed automatic
transmission, which spins the wheels through a positraction rear
axle with 3.00:1 gearing to enhance the car's handling
capabilities. The exterior of this T-Bird really helps it stand

VIN and Door Tag decode as follows:
VIN- 6Y870166373
6: 1966 model year
Y: Wixom, Michigan Ford Assembly Plant, U.S.A.
87: Thunderbird 2-door "Town Landeau" (blind quarter vinyl top)
0: 428 C.I. V8, 4-barrel carburetor
166373: Serial number
DOOR TAG-
63D: Thunderbird 2-door "Town Landeau"
R: "Ivy Green Iridescent" exterior paint
28: "Ivy Gold" interior vinyl trim
27E: Production date of May 27th, 1966
53: Kansas City, Missouri D.S.O. (District Sales Office)
1: Standard 3.00:1 positraction rear axle
4: Ford "C-6" 3-speed automatic transmission
